Output 729bd6d3b4f15bce8543137c51f94cdc9a8d0e74342a52505940b027f2868292:1

value
645825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b5223f1fa12a7b8ae1a03fb3d9511cdd22b505 OP_EQUAL
address
342wojaQjG8GuKhPKiiSBbK7qMK6KA9Zon
transaction
729bd6d3b4f15bce8543137c51f94cdc9a8d0e74342a52505940b027f2868292
confirmations
263043
spent
true